Enabling activities for the Stockholm Convention on Persistent Organic Pollutants (POPs): National Implementation Plan for the Gambia
Project Summary
Within the overall objective of the Stockholm Convention, which is to protect human health and the environment from POPs, the project will: i.Prepare the ground for implementation of the Convention in the Gambia ii.Assist the Gambia in meeting its reporting and other obligations under the Convention; iii.Strengthen Gambia’s national capacity to manage POPs and chemicals generaly.
